Construction Industry

One of the primary sectors driving the demand for galvanized pipes is the construction industry. Galvanized pipes are extensively used in plumbing systems. Their corrosion – resistant properties make them ideal for carrying water, whether it’s for domestic or commercial buildings. In residential construction, they are used for water supply lines, drainage systems, and even in some cases, for heating systems. For commercial buildings, large – scale plumbing networks rely on galvanized pipes to ensure long – term durability.

In addition to plumbing, galvanized pipes are also used in structural applications. They can be found in building frames, handrails, and fencing. The strength and corrosion resistance of galvanized pipes make them a reliable choice for these structural elements, especially in areas where exposure to the elements is a concern. For example, in coastal regions where the air is salty and can accelerate corrosion, galvanized pipes offer a longer service life compared to non – galvanized alternatives.

The growth of the construction industry, both in developed and developing countries, has a direct impact on the demand for galvanized pipes. As urbanization continues, new buildings are being constructed, and existing ones are being renovated. This continuous cycle of construction and renovation creates a steady demand for galvanized pipes.

Agriculture

The agricultural sector is another significant consumer of galvanized pipes. In irrigation systems, galvanized pipes are used to transport water from a source, such as a well or a reservoir, to the fields. Their ability to withstand rust and corrosion is essential in an environment where they are often exposed to water and soil. Moreover, galvanized pipes are used in the construction of greenhouses. They provide the framework for the structure, and their durability ensures that the greenhouse can withstand various weather conditions.

The increasing global population has led to a growing demand for food, which in turn has driven the expansion of the agricultural sector. As farmers look for more efficient ways to irrigate their crops and protect them from the elements, the demand for galvanized pipes in agriculture is expected to rise.

Manufacturing

In the manufacturing industry, galvanized pipes are used in a variety of applications. They can be found in conveyor systems, where they serve as the framework for moving materials. The corrosion – resistant nature of galvanized pipes ensures that the conveyor systems can operate smoothly over an extended period without the need for frequent maintenance.

Galvanized pipes are also used in the production of furniture. They can be used to create the frames for chairs, tables, and other pieces of furniture. The strength and aesthetic appeal of galvanized pipes make them a popular choice among furniture manufacturers.

The growth of the manufacturing sector, especially in emerging economies, has contributed to the increased demand for galvanized pipes. As more factories are established and production processes become more complex, the need for reliable and durable materials like galvanized pipes continues to grow.

Energy Sector

The energy sector also has a significant demand for galvanized pipes. In the oil and gas industry, galvanized pipes are used in pipelines for transporting oil and gas. The corrosion – resistant properties of these pipes are crucial in preventing leaks and ensuring the safe and efficient transportation of these valuable resources.

In the renewable energy sector, galvanized pipes are used in the construction of wind turbines and solar panel mounts. They provide the structural support needed for these energy – generating systems. As the world shifts towards more sustainable energy sources, the demand for galvanized pipes in the renewable energy sector is likely to increase.

Factors Affecting Market Demand

Several factors influence the market demand for galvanized pipes. One of the most significant factors is the price of raw materials. The cost of steel and zinc, the primary components of galvanized pipes, can fluctuate due to changes in global supply and demand. For example, if the price of zinc increases, the cost of producing galvanized pipes will also rise, which may lead to a decrease in demand as buyers look for more cost – effective alternatives.

Economic conditions also play a crucial role. In times of economic growth, the construction, manufacturing, and energy sectors tend to expand, leading to an increase in the demand for galvanized pipes. Conversely, during economic downturns, these sectors may contract, resulting in a decrease in demand.

Technological advancements can also impact the market demand for galvanized pipes. New manufacturing processes may lead to the development of alternative materials that are more cost – effective or have better performance characteristics. For example, the development of composite materials may pose a threat to the market share of galvanized pipes in some applications.

Market Trends

One of the emerging trends in the galvanized pipe market is the increasing demand for high – strength galvanized pipes. These pipes are designed to withstand higher pressures and loads, making them suitable for more demanding applications. For example, in the oil and gas industry, high – strength galvanized pipes are used in deep – sea pipelines where the pressure is extremely high.

Another trend is the growing focus on environmental sustainability. As consumers and industries become more environmentally conscious, there is a demand for galvanized pipes that are produced using more sustainable manufacturing processes. This includes reducing the energy consumption and emissions associated with the production of galvanized pipes.
